Important BD™ Test Strip Information
•Use only BD™ Test Strips when testing.
• Remove the test strip from the vial only when ready to test.
•Store test strips at room temperature below 86°F (30°C). 
Do not refrigerate or freeze.
•Test strips should be stored only in original vial.
• Keep vial cap closed tightly after each use.
•Do not use the test strip if the expiration date has passed, 
for this may cause inaccurate results.
•Test strips should only be stored for 3 months after opening 
the vial. When first opening a new vial of test strips, count 
forward 3 months and write that date on vial. Discard any remaining
test strips after the date you have written on the vial.
•Do not tamper with test strip.

Use Paradigm Link™ to download Paradigm
®
Model 511, 512 or Higher Pumps to PC.
• A BD USB cable (included in your Medtronic Minimed 
Solutions™ software kit) may be used as shown to 
connect meter to computer. 
• Medtronic MiniMed Solutions™ software (not included 
in meter kit) may be used to download Paradigm
®
Model 511, 512 or higher pump data through your 
meter to the PC. Refer to the User Guide provided 
with your software for using your PC with your 
meter or your pump.
NOTE:
The meter cannot be used to
test blood glucose when connected by
the cable to the computer.
